Renting An Emergency Boiler For Your Business

If a business experiences major problems with its boiler, it could suffer major disruptions to its operations. Depending on the particular problems that your business's boiler is experiencing, it may be without this appliance for a lengthy period until the appropriate repairs are completed or a new unit is able to be installed. Emergency rental boilers are one option that can minimize these impacts as much as possible so that the losses the business suffers can be mitigated.

Emergency Boilers Can Allow Your Business To Quickly Restore Functionality After A Major Failure

One of the most important benefits of emergency rental boilers is the speed at which they can be delivered and set up. In many instances, the business may be able to have its rental boiler delivered and operational in a single day. Without this option, the business would have to either stay closed or operate at diminished capacity until its boiler is repaired. This can make the rental and set-up fees that these providers charge a necessary investment for limiting the scale of the disruptions and losses the business may suffer.

Rental Boilers Are Highly Customizable

Rental boilers come in a range of strengths and sizes. This can lead to businesses having a great deal of control over the amount of heat and steam that it is outputting. For larger businesses, this can be instrumental in allowing them to generate enough heat and steam for their systems. However, it can also be useful for smaller businesses that may need more limited capacity. During the process of renting one of these appliances, you should be prepared to decide on the output capacity that you will need. If you have the documentation for your company's previous boiler, this can be simple information to look up. However, if you do not have access to this documentation, the boiler rental service may assist you with choosing a unit that will have the output capacity that you need.

Rental Boilers Should Be Insured

It is common for rental boilers to be located outdoors in a trailer that is placed adjacent to the building. Due to this, these units may be vulnerable to some types of damage, and this can make it wise to purchase insurance coverage for them. An example of this could be a strong storm damaging the trailer or causing other damage to this system. Fortunately, insuring an emergency rental boiler is extremely affordable, and many rental providers will make it easy to include this type of coverage in the rental agreement.
